Han Deok-su: "The September Crisis Rumor Caused by Self-Employed Is Not True"

Prime Minister Han Duck-soo dismissed the September self-employed crisis theory as unfounded.


On the 13th, during the economic sector government questioning session at the National Assembly, Han responded to a question from People Power Party lawmaker Yoon Sang-hyun about the 'September crisis theory' originating from the self-employed, saying, "Already last September, maturity extension measures were taken for 92% of the loan balances until September 2025."


Han explained, "98% of borrowers with repayment deferrals have completed the preparation of repayment plans," adding, "For some borrowers who may be at risk of default and are not included in this group, financial restructuring is planned through a new start fund of about 30 trillion won provided by last year's supplementary budget."


According to the Financial Services Commission, as of the end of March, the loan balance subject to maturity extension and repayment deferral measures was 85.3 trillion won, a decrease of 14.7 trillion won compared to the end of September last year. During the same period, the total number of borrowers decreased by 46,000, from 434,000 to 388,000.


Loans subject to maturity extension measures amounted to 78.8 trillion won, accounting for 92% of the total. The scale of principal and interest repayment deferrals was 6.6 trillion won (16,100 borrowers), representing about 8% of the total.


Han added, "For borrowers under the loan repayment deferral measures, financial institutions have also negotiated and prepared repayment plans to adjust debts by methods such as lowering interest rates."
